FAFSA (Free Application for Federal Student Aid) You will need to complete the FAFSA form to apply for federal student aid such as federal grants, work-study funds, and loans. Completing and submitting the FAFSA form is free and easier than ever, and it gives you access to federal student aid—the largest source of aid— to help you pay for college or career/trade school. In addition, many states and colleges use your FAFSA information to determine your eligibility for state and school aid. Some private aid providers may use your FAFSA information to determine whether you qualify for their aid.
BigFuture When you complete one or more qualifying steps on BigFuture, you’ll be automatically entered into monthly drawings for $500 or $40,000 until February of your senior year. You can begin in your sophomore year. You will need a College Board account. If you don’t have one, you can click here to create one. Be sure to use or create a professional-sounding email as this will be used throughout your high school years.
